About

BFI Flare is the UK's longest-running and most celebrated LGBTQIA+ film festival, presented annually by the British Film Institute at BFI Southbank. First staged in 1986 as the London Lesbian & Gay Film Festival, it has grown into one of the world's most important showcases for queer cinema — featuring premieres, archive restorations, shorts programmes, and filmmaker conversations across almost four decades.

The festival champions bold, diverse storytelling from LGBTQIA+ filmmakers around the globe, spanning narrative features, documentaries, experimental work, and episodic content. Beyond the screenings, BFI Flare offers industry events, panel discussions, and social gatherings that make it as much a community celebration as a film programme.
